Legacy Club is a 9,330 square foot indoor/outdoor rooftop cocktail lounge on the 60th floor of Circa Resort & Casino in Downtown Las Vegas — the highest rooftop venue on the Fremont Street corridor and one of the tallest public-access nightlife spaces in the city. The 60th floor panoramic view encompasses the entire Las Vegas Strip to the south, the Fremont Street Experience directly below, and the Spring Mountains to the west — a 360-degree cityscape perspective unavailable at any Strip hotel rooftop, which typically face a single boulevard direction. The space displays 500 custom two-ounce gold bars with the Circa logo numbered 1 through 500, alongside a live gold market price ticker — a design signature that runs through Circa founder Derek Stevens's commitment to Las Vegas heritage iconography. Live jazz and prohibition-era music plays Friday and Saturday nights from 10 PM, giving Legacy Club a distinct acoustic identity compared to the DJ-driven format of every Strip rooftop bar; the craft cocktail program and elevated dress code — closed-toe shoes required, no athletic wear, no shorts — position this as the definitive upscale alternative to the mega-club circuit for guests who want downtown views and genuine cocktail culture. Wynn Field Club is the official premium nightclub experience inside Allegiant Stadium, established through a partnership between Wynn Resorts and the Las Vegas Raiders. The 10,691-square-foot venue occupies the north end zone at field level, offering concert-goers and Raiders fans a luxury nightlife environment with direct sightlines across the entire playing field. The club was designed by the Wynn Las Vegas creative team behind XS Nightclub and Encore Beach Club — bringing Wynn's signature production standards (45,000-watt sound system, two DJ booths, a 9-foot by 35-foot video display, four private bars) into the stadium environment alongside 42 TVs. The 2026 concert calendar includes AC/DC Power Up Tour, Guns N' Roses, Chris Brown & Usher, and Karol G performances where Wynn Field Club provides the premium VIP lane inside the stadium. Las Vegas Raiders regular and preseason games, plus UNLV football, extend the schedule through December 2026. Unlike traditional Strip nightclubs, access requires a base event ticket plus the Field Club upgrade through wynnsocial.com — but Wynn's hospitality standards (elevated food and beverage, private expedited entry, dedicated bar service, DJ programming) make it the premier VIP experience at Allegiant Stadium and the only stadium-based nightclub in Las Vegas operated by a Strip resort brand.
